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| beaded chestnut | Black arion |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Mollusca (Mollusks) |
| Class | Insecta (Insects) | Gastropoda (Gastropoda) |
| Order |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) | Stylommatophora (Stylommatophora) |
| Family | Noctuidae | Arionidae |
| Genus | Agrochola | Arion |
| Species | Agrochola lychnidis | Arion ater |
